As part of National Highways work to replace the A533 Expressway bridge, they will be closing the M56 motorway in a single direction for two full weekends in September and October 2022. These closures will allow them to install new safety barriers in preparation for the new bridge. The A533 Expressway will remain open during these closures.

  • 9pm Friday 23 September – 6am Monday 26 September

M56 WESTBOUND ONLY, between junctions 11 and 12

  • 9pm Friday 30 September – 6am Monday 3 October

M56 EASTBOUND ONLY, between junctions 12 and 11

Diversion routes will be in place and clearly signed.

Towards the end of October, they will be ready to lift the new bridge into position. To do this, National Highways plan to close the M56 in both directions for one full weekend. At the same time, they will also need to close the A533 Expressway bridge in both directions, between Murdishaw roundabout and Preston Brook.

  • 9pm Friday 28 October – 6am Monday 31 October

M56 in BOTH directions, between junctions 11 and 12 and

A533 Expressway bridge, in both directions
